1 of the 2 Herring Gull chicks currently in the nest on our chimney stack decided to jump down into our living room grate. Uninjured & placed on the flat roof next door, the adults continue to tend to him along with the remaining sibling up on the stack. Noisey & poop everywhere but great to watch.

A fantastic day out at RSPB Minsmere this week with a Purple Heron the highlight and a Roseate Tern a close runner-up. Hobby, Marsh Harrier, Bearded Tit, GWEgret, Red Kite and Norfolk Hawker an interesting supporting cast and a Kittiwake nesting tower offshore a welcome initiative.

A good day out at RSPB Ham Wall this week with plenty of Dragon/Damselflies on the wing despite the cool breeze and intermittent sunshine. Banded Demoiselle, Red-eyed Damselfly, Four-spotted Chaser and Scarce Chaser seen along with around 10 Hobby expertly hunting them over the reedbeds.
